Minecraft ClientJava / Bedrock
Xbox Live / Mojang AuthMicrosoft Auth
OAuth 2.0REST
BungeeCord / VelocityReverse Proxy
Game ServerOne World Instance
JavaPaper
World GeneratorProcedural Gen
Chunk ManagerLoad / Unload
Java
Tick Engine20 TPS Game Loop
Redstone SimulatorLogic Engine
Entity SystemMobs, Items, Players
Java
World StorageAnvil / LevelDB
Player Data DBInventory & Stats
NBTLevelDB
Minecraft RealmsManaged Hosting
AzureJava
Marketplace / DLCBedrock Store
Skin / Resource CDNtextures.minecraft.net
Plugin / Mod RuntimeBukkit / Fabric
JavaBukkit API
Press enter or space to select a node. You can then use the arrow keys to move the node around. Press delete to remove it and escape to cancel.
Press enter or space to select an edge. You can then press delete to remove it or escape to cancel.
MSA / Xbox Live: unified account, 2FA, parental controls